Output 60693cb6ec086218fab975445aa675f54d079994aa8b0741b14b52f858c83ee9:20

value
3340086
script pubkey
OP_0 OP_PUSHBYTES_20 b26ec0f8d9d976a67d87b400f17738bb295d4fb7
address
bc1qkfhvp7xem9m2vlv8ksq0zaechv546nahwkguxg
transaction
60693cb6ec086218fab975445aa675f54d079994aa8b0741b14b52f858c83ee9
spent
true